    Meaning of Ascendance

    The state of rising to or being in a position of power or importance

    Definitions

    • The state of rising to or being in a position of power or importance
    • * The process of gaining or increasing power, influence, or prestige
    • * A state of superiority or dominance

    Etymology of Ascendance

    The word "ascendance" has its roots in the Old French word "ascender", which is derived from the Latin word "ascendere", meaning "to climb" or "to rise"
    Historically, the term has been used to describe the act of rising to a higher position or state, and has been associated with concepts of power, influence, and prestige
